The Edinburgh Castle

You must have heard about the city of Edinburgh, which is one of the most popular cities in Scotland. One of the most important and beautiful and works is none other than the Edinburgh Castle, which is worth visiting, on your trip to Scotland. It was actually built in the 13th century, and it is one of the most popular national Monument recognized by the government of Scotland. Apart from the beauty of the castle, the narrow passage to enter this castle is also quite beautiful, and the surroundings is beautified with a number of beautiful flower trees, which multiplies the beauty of the castle and the garden.

Loch Lomond Lake

If you are fond of the beauty of nature, you should definitely visit Loch Lomond, which is one of the largest lakes in Scotland, as a part of it is also located in Britain. The lake is not only beautiful because of the blue water present on it, but it is also popular and beautiful because of its surroundings, as it is surrounded by a number of Highlands around it. From any portion, close to the lake, you can get a beautiful view of the lake as well as the surroundings around it. They are also a number of amusements available in that lake, which include boating, which attracts a number of visitors to the lake of Loch Lomond.
